CHALLENGE 1

Starting this Saturday 21st March, the first challenge for the week.

Mumbles duathlon was cancelled but some members have trained to take part, so we want you to ride the route and complete the runs in your own time over 6 days. In return for completing the challenge your name will go into a hat and we do a live draw on a Friday night 8pm to see who wins a prize. Simples.

The challenge for week 1 – Mumbles Duathlon

1. Ride Mumbles Duathlon bike loop. You will need to record the short or long distance of the bike route. Starting at Blackpill so you can ride there from Mumbles, Swansea or come down the cycle track to take part.

2. Run or walk 2.5 km, any route, trail or road, hills or flat, you choose

3. Run or walk 5km, any route, trail or road, hills or flat, you choose

All 3 parts of the challenge must be completed by Friday 27th March 6pm, to be in with a chance of going into the prize draw.

It’s all about getting members out of the house and focusing on the weekly challenge. You  can do it in your own time, or with someone (Remember social distancing).

Its not about being the fastest on the bike or the quickest 5km run it’s all about being active. You will of course get the kudos of being at the top of the leaderboard 😉
